Got these cute Bear, Xmas Tree and Flower shapes Pancake/Egg Ring from Daiso. They came in a few design and you can use it for either making pan-cake directly by placing the lightly oiled mould on the non-stick pan and top with pancake batter and fry as usual pancake method.
Or you can use it to fry cute design of sunny egg for the kids on weekend breakfast or you it as a cutter to cut shape out of bread, omelet or even use it to mould the rice into different shape accordingly.
I have use this to make flower shape pancakes and the bear ring mould to make Bear Onigiri bento and decorate it with side dishes.
You can use this heart-shape ring mould to make lovely heart-shape sunny eggs, heart-shape pancake, bread and etc for Valentine Day meal....

You can get these Animaletti from a brand called Pasta Zara which can be found is most NTUC or Cold Storage. This cute and fascinating Pasta come in two design packaging as in either Assorted Animals or Transportation. It cost about $2.80 per pack for 500g. So this will be actually more economical that the Disney Pasta :) To achieve this objective, Pasta ZARA designed a particular type of pasta in the shape of cars, animals, spinning tops, ears of corn and Sardinian gnocchi.These shapes stimulate the young one’s curiosity, tempting them to put this pasta which looks so much fun into their mouths and at the same time, enabling them to appreciate a good first course with its relative carbohydrates which are so important for the body. In other words, a pasta that satisfies the palate (with its quality) but also the eye (with its appearance).
